[17:05:08] <atropos> мужики, как передать дескриптор сокета в функцию?
[17:06:27] <atropos> пробовал передавать как число int бесполезняк
[17:06:43] <atropos> передавал как указатель тоже самое
[17:06:59] <imax> код показывай
[17:07:08] <gemelen> хыхы
[17:07:11] <imax> дескриптор в userspace — это именно int
[17:08:22] <atropos> user(buff + 5, (DYN_CLI_STATE *) &client_auth, dyn_client_sock);
[17:08:26] <atropos> вызов функции
[17:08:50] <imax> весь код показывай
[17:09:11] <imax> включая код функции и как ты открываешь сокет
[17:09:14] <atropos> void user(const char *, struct DYN_CLI_STATE *, int)
[17:09:16] <imax> только не прямо сюда
[17:09:18] <atropos> прототип
[17:09:26] <atropos> сокет открыт
[17:09:31] <imax> http://pastebin.com
[17:09:37] <atropos> в него можно писать
[17:09:41] <atropos> и читать тоже можно
[17:09:46] <imax> atropos, show us ur code
[17:10:24] <imax> по твоим пересказываниям можно только сказать что ты что-то делаешь не так
[17:10:53] <atropos> send(dyn_client_sock, MSG_PASS_AUTH_SUCC, sizeof(MSG_PASS_AUTH_SUCC), 0);
[17:11:15] <atropos> всё
[17:11:22] <atropos> эти 3 строчки не работают
[17:11:24] <imax> какое слово из "весь код" мне повторить?
[17:11:32] <imax> "не работают" — это как?
[17:11:37] <gemelen> ачо там вызов вернул, про чо ругается — пофигу
[17:12:20] <atropos> с этим тоже проблема — не могу понять как вывести из форка в исходную консольку ошибку чайлда.
[17:12:42] <atropos> я думал что передать сокет в функцию рядовая задача
[17:12:56] <atropos> и мне просто покажут как это надо сделать
[17:12:58] <Ingersol> лучше спросил бы проконсольку в форке...
[17:13:02] <imax> уффф
[17:13:33] <imax> atropos, если я увижу ещё три сообщения от тебя в ни в одном из них не будет ссылки на код — забаню
[17:14:35] <atropos> imax ты всё такой же
[17:14:43] <atropos> http://paste.kde.org/559256/
[17:14:46] <atropos> на читай
[17:16:14] <atropos> м.. немножко не то
[17:16:52] <atropos> свежак из буфера, в файле ещё старый код который выше показал
[17:17:13] <atropos> но суть та же — не пашет
[17:17:19] <imax> так как именно "не работает"?
[17:17:33] <atropos> не пишет в сокет
[17:17:36] <imax> и кто за тебя должен проверять что возвратил send и errno
[17:17:38] <imax> ?
[17:17:50] <imax> почему ты так решил?
[17:18:15] <atropos> ну... в сокет смотрел телнетом
[17:18:23] <atropos> MSG_HELLO пришло
[17:18:39] <atropos> всё что user() должно было отправить — нет
[17:19:05] <atropos> как чайлдом в родительскую консольку писать?
[17:19:18] <imax> printf()
[17:19:41] <imax> вставляй проверки возвращаемого значения, чо
[17:20:18] <imax> man perror заодно почитай
[17:21:17] <Ingersol> передавать int & dyn_client_sock не надо, пиши int dyn_client_sock
[17:21:41] <atropos> передавал
[17:21:53] <atropos> тоже на пашет
[17:21:57] <Ingersol> смотри на логи тогда
[17:22:03] <Ingersol> без логов нет программирования
[17:22:04] <xray> тебе говорят, как должно быть
[17:22:09] <xray> Ищи ошибки теперь
[17:22:10] <imax> atropos, ещё раз напишешь "не пашет" — забаню
[17:22:35] <imax> ты должен знать что тебе возвратил send() и что при этом было в errno
[17:22:49] <imax> иначе — вали обратно в дворники
[17:23:00] <atropos> imax иди нафиг у тебя мозг не пашет если ты бесишься со слов "не пашет"
[17:23:07] atropos (~atropos@2.95.168.169) left the channel.
:(
gelraen
29.09.2012 16:25 work-laptop
Do you really want to delete ?
Приходи к нам в c_plus_plus@cjr, тебе там будет ок.
хуй там, у вас там пиздец какой-то
Што.
у вас там пиздёжь о чём попало и среди этого мусора хрен что выловишь, а на #c гробовая тишина пока не придёт вот такой нуб
да ты же бородатый чсвшны бсдшник!
фу таким быть
Мной.
куда нажать чтоб появилась тян?
не можешь помочь — молчи, мб другой кто-то сможет
на Y-хромосому в зиготе.
пиздец. я как раз и хотел ему помочь, а он упорно сопротивлялся.
Увидел 23/23, зиготанул.
Пиздец нахуй блядь.
:3 :3 :3
насильно насаждаем добро-с? так-тааак.
А, я не туда ответил, это на /9 было. У тебя как раз все нормик, скоро попустит.
но я всё равно не знаю куда нажать :(
На член нажми-подрочи.
не помогает :(
для начала можешь нажать на шейку матки. Что-то да точно появится, хоть и не факт что тян.
блять :3 чтоб на неё нажать надо её сначала найти, а для этого нужно чтобы появилась тян
Слабо давишь.
-_\\\
Пару лет назад запилили искусственные яичники. Действуй.
facepalm.jpg
Што.
что сложного в том, чтобы найти шейку матки? она на дне влагалища, если что.
ДНИЩЕ ЕБАНОЕ
ВЛАГАЛИЩЕ ЕБАНОЕ
мной.
и другими парнями.
> @ulidtko
> и другими парнями
ну не дедфудами же.
Да, не мной :(
@L29Ah, перелогиньтесь.